Updates from National Convention!

In July 2022, Members from across the country came together in Dallas-Fort Worth, TX to celebrate Sisterhood and to get things done! Here is a look at some of the work approved by the Delegation:

- Working towards more inclusive language by replacing the historical terms " Colony/Colonization" with " Petitioning Group/Establishment" and by removing gendered language from all National Documents.

- Codifying the Infinity Chapter and Treasuring Ceremonies, including a new ceremonial item- Creating a Technical Major Expansion spreadsheet to simplify the process

- Sending important organizational development tasks, including: investigation of facility corporation creation, researching chapter management software, developing trademark licensing policy and planning for emergency response, to new and established committees.

- Accepting a new slate of Leadership Consultants for 2022-2023.

- Electing Audrey Heuser as National Director of Finance, Emma Bachman as National Director of Operations and Ally DiCarlo as National Director of Communications, set to take office January 1, 2023.

- Restructuring the National Board of Directors by adding the two new positions of NDoC and NDoM (effective immediately) and replacing the role of National Director of Administration with an Executive Director (at the end of the current NDoA term).

New National Director Positions

Two new National Board of Director positions were ratified at Convention in July. The Board is expanding, which means special elections!

The National Director of Communications (NDoC) oversees internal and external communication for the Organization.

The National Director of Membership's (NDoM) duties include: Overseeing Membership development and retention, Coordinating virtual Professional Development workshops for both Active and Alumnae Members, Assisting with and serving as the primary point of contact for new Alumnae Chapters
